The aim of our research is to present a context-awareness multi-agent-based mobile educational game that can generate a series of learning activities for users doing On-the-Job training and make users interact with specific objects in their working environment. We reveal multi-agent architecture (MAA) into the mobile educational game design to achieve the goals of developing a lightweight, flexible, and scalable game on the platform with limited resources such as mobile phones. A scenario with several workplaces, research space, meeting rooms, and a variety of items and devices in 11th floor of a university’s building is used to demonstrate the idea and mechanism proposed by this research.
